Series Analysis:
Released for the franchise's twenty-fifth anniversary, Pokémon Evolutions functions as a sophisticated retrospective of the series' core regions. By reversing the games' chronological order—starting with Galar and ending in Kanto—the series provided a fresh perspective on established lore. Its legacy is defined by high-fidelity animation and a mature narrative lens, focusing on internal struggles and pivotal turning points often glossed over in the primary television show. It successfully bridged the gap between casual viewers and veteran fans, proving these digital worlds possess a depth worth exploring through prestige storytelling.
